What is a Ceiling T Bar?


A ceiling T bar, also known as a T-grid or T-bar ceiling grid system, is a framework made from metal, typically galvanized steel or aluminum, which supports lightweight ceiling tiles or panels. The ‘T’ shape refers to the design of the grid components that form a suspended ceiling structure. This system is particularly valued for its versatility, allowing for easy installation and maintenance, as well as the ability to incorporate various lighting and air conditioning fixtures seamlessly.


Benefits of Using T Bar Systems


1. Aesthetic Appeal T bar ceilings offer a clean, modern look that can enhance the visual appeal of any space. They can accommodate various types of tiles, allowing for customization in color, texture, and design.


2. Acoustic Control Many ceiling tiles that work with T-bar systems are designed to manage sound, ensuring that spaces remain quiet and comfortable. This is especially beneficial in environments like offices, schools, and healthcare facilities.


3. Quick Installation The installation process for T bar ceilings is straightforward. Workers can install the grid system relatively quickly, which reduces labor costs and time on site.


4. Accessible Space One of the major advantages of a suspended ceiling with T bars is the accessibility it offers. The ceiling space above the tiles can be used for running electrical wires, plumbing, and HVAC systems, and tiles can be easily lifted out for maintenance access.


5. Energy Efficiency The choice of materials and the potential for thermal insulation in T bar ceiling systems can contribute to better energy efficiency. This is especially important in commercial buildings looking to reduce their energy consumption.

Installation Process


Installing a T bar ceiling involves several essential steps


1. Planning and Measurement Proper planning is crucial. Measure the room dimensions accurately and assess any existing fixtures or ductwork that may affect the installation.


2. Laying Out the Grid Begin laying out the T bar grid. Use chalk lines to extend reference lines on the ceiling to ensure that the grid is straight and level.


3. Installing the Main Bars Main T bars are typically placed at regular intervals, depending on the size of the tiles being used. Each T bar must be securely attached to the ceiling above.


4. Adding Cross Tees Once the main bars are installed, cross tees are added to complete the grid layout. This helps to create a firm structure where ceiling tiles can rest.


5. Inserting Ceiling Tiles With the grid completed, ceiling tiles can be inserted into the framework. Care should be taken to align the tiles correctly for a uniform appearance.


Architectural Design Impact


Ceiling T bar systems offer flexibility in design that can greatly enhance architectural aesthetics. Architects can manipulate height and space perception by adjusting the depth of the ceiling. Furthermore, the ability to integrate lighting and other fixtures into the ceiling design allows for creative expression and innovative solutions in commercial and residential buildings.
